Summary:USD/CAD climbed toward weekly highs as falling oil prices weakened the Canadian dollar despite strong domestic trade data. Canada’s trade surplus reached a four-year high, but the positive economic data was overshadowed by the sharp decline in crude oil prices. Markets are reassessing Federal Reserve expectations, limiting gains in the US dollar after weaker-than-expected US economic data. USD/CAD rises as oil prices pressure the Canadian dollar The USD/CAD exchange rate extended its gains on Wednesday, climbing toward the 1.4080 level as another sharp decline in oil prices continued to pressure the Canadian dollar. Awareness is growing, too. Six in 10 respondents (59%) correctly identified the definition of cryptocurrency, up from 54% in 2023 and 51% in 2022. More than one third (34%) were aware of stablecoins and 24% had heard of RWA tokens. The most common reason for buying crypto among investors was to diversify their investment portfolio (28%), followed by the expectation of long-term growth in asset value (27%) and as a speculative investment (26%). USD The greenback ground lower again on Wednesday, with the slipping around 0.2% to near 99.7. The data offered little support, delivering a distinctly stagflationary mix. ADP employment rose just 44k against 65k expected, and while the ISM services index held at 54.1, its employment gauge slid into contraction at 47.4 even as prices paid climbed to 70.3. Granted, FOMC hawks have pushed back against the soft jobs signal, with Governor Cook warning she is prepared to act on a hike absent renewed disinflation, but September hike odds continue to retreat, weighing on the dollar at the margin. Analysts at Bank of America expect USD/CAD to rise towards 1.44 in September as further Fed rate hikes support the Dollar, before the pair retreats through 2027. The US Dollar to Canadian Dollar exchange rate slipped lower on Wednesday, but currency analysts at Bank of America still see room for USD/CAD to climb towards 1.44 over the next couple of months. The pair traded around 1.4018, down 0.34% on the day. USD/CAD also fell 1.36% in July, reversing part of June’s 2.97% rise, and has spent the past month moving between roughly 1.3990 and 1.4240.
